Swan Reach SA — Suburb Profile

Population, median income, rent prices, housing costs and demographics for Swan Reach, South Australia. ABS Census 2021.

The population of Swan Reach SA is 271 according to the 2021 Census. The median personal income in Swan Reach is $529 per week ($27,508 per year). Median rent in Swan Reach is $200 per week ($867 per month). Swan Reach has a median age of 59 years, older than the national median of 38. Swan Reach has a population density of 0.7 people per km².

The most common overseas birthplace in Swan Reach is England. The most common religion is No Religion (35% of residents). After English, the most spoken language is IAL Punjabi. The median monthly mortgage repayment in Swan Reach is $650.

There were 8 recorded offences in Swan Reach in 2025-26, a rate of 30 offences per 1,000 people. The most common offence category was property damage (2 offences).
